The era of immersive health technologies

Immersive health technologies are revolutionising the delivery of frontline healthcare, therapeutic techniques, and research. They also offer great potential to improve the training of healthcare professionals through reality-simulation training. The work that we are doing at The Allan Lab is really exciting and is generating new ideas, concepts and clinical opportunities.

We have put together a review paper summarising the current developments and uses of four types of immersive health technology: augmented reality, virtual reality, machine learning, and artificial intelligence. The article describes examples of their use in healthcare, opportunities and pitfalls, and how the use of these technologies could be improved further in the future are highlighted. How technology that once appeared to be only visionary is now part of day-to-day life for many patients and consumers is also addressed.
